In 2020-2021, 121 degrees and certificates were awarded to dental support services students who went to a Maryland college or university. This makes it the #100 most popular major in the state.

This report analyzed 8 schools in Maryland to see which ones were the most popular associate degree programs for students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Dental Support Services program at each school on the list.

Our 2023 rankings named Allegany College of Maryland the most popular school in Maryland for dental support services students working on their associate degree. Allegany College of Maryland is a small public school located in the city of Cumberland.
About 97% of the students majoring in dental support at the school are women while 3% are male.
While working on their Associate Degree, dental support majors at Allegany College of Maryland accumulate an average of around $21,005 in student debt.
